By April Marie · Posted
I started shaving my legs years ago - I started getting an occasional mild contact rash on my shins. That became my excuse to shave them for both me and my wife. Over time, the rash didn't expand...but my shaving did. Full legs....groin......chest......and finally my arms. Keeping the rash at bay was my excuse until I came out to my wife. Now I typically do a full shave on Sunday mornings. The hair is lighter but I just feel better with it gone - it helps with the dysphoria and dysmorphia. I will also typically do a chest touch-up mid week since I notice the growth more there. I wish someone would invent a pill that would stop hair growth everywhere except on your head. -

By KayC · Posted
Shaving my legs (very early on) was the first BIG STEP in my self-affirmation. It also felt Real and Natural ... Finally (after all my years with fairly hairy legs). My wife was shocked but I think she thought it was 'OK' as long as didn't go any farther ... well that wasn't going to happen. It was actually Step 1 of many to follow. I did feel the need to hide it from others but eventually didn't care. And, men shaving their legs is much more common these days. Home IPL (laser) made the hair removal permanent over the course of a year or so. Whatever was leftover has been reduced to peach-fuzz by HRT. I don't deny or reject all my years living in the realm of cis-males ... it was part of my Journey to get to where I am today. But since committing to HRT and living in an environment and community that supports my transition, I find it difficult to go back into Boy-mode. The times that I do have to do that ... I can feel the dysphoria rising up again. No going back ... at this point.
